Abstract
PURPOSE:To reduce number of circuit components by constituting a feedback capacitance between terminals of an active component, an inductive element, an active element and a capacitive component having the coupling capacitance to the next stage with the active element by the electrode pattern provided to both faces of the one high dielectric constant board. CONSTITUTION:The electrode pattern 17 is provided on the surface of the feedback capacitance between the base and emitter and the electrode pattern 18 in pairs with the electrode pattern is provided on the rear face and the electrode pattern 18 is connected to the emitter electrode of the surface through a through holes 19 of both the sides. That is, a capacitance exists definitely between the electrode pattern 17 on the surface and the electrode pattern 18 of the rear side and the feedback capacitance between the base and emitter is formed in a conventional device. Similarly. the feedback capacitance between the emitter and ground is formed by the electrode pattern 20 and the electrode pattern 21 of the rear side or and the collector and inductive element and the emitter and the coupling capacitance to the next stage are formed respectively by electrode patterns 22-25. Thus, the number of mounted components is reduced.
